      The Future Subsea Controllable Cooler is a second-generation passive subsea cooler that is simple, robust, reliable, and operates according to proven principles. The FSCC utilizes the natural buoyancy of seawater around the cooling pipes to maximize cooling rate and minimize overall size and weight. The FSCC is designed to operate in a stagnant seawater environment, but flow will increase performance.
